| dc.description | The authors compute the long-time asymptotics for solutions of the NLS equation just under the assumption that the initial data lies in a weighted Sobolev space. In earlier work (see e.g. [DZ1],[DIZ]) high orders of decay and smoothness are required for the initial data. The method here is a further development of the steepest descent method of [DZ1], and replaces certain absolute type estimates in [DZ1] with cancellation from oscillations. | |
